Last week, Maks, K-Max, and I attended the Jeremih and K’la T-Mobile Sidekick 4G Secret Show. It took place at Park West, and I must say they have a BEAUTIFUL venue. The highlight of the event was of course K’la and Jeremih’s performances, which were accompanied by live bands adding to the momentum of the whole experience and allowing both artists to really ‘play’ on stage. Jeremih was especially electric controlling the rhythm of his set going from dance songs to slow jams, while using the band and backup singers to really experiment and accentuate his music. He does an amazing job mashing up his songs with other classics to achieve one of the best dynamic shows I’ve seen live. Check out his Adele cover “Rumour Has It” in case you missed it in the past! However, this event not only gave us a great performance, but there was also free food and drinks, giveaways such as T-Mobile light-up rings, and Jeremih and K’la T-shirts that you could have custom printed. 

Following their performances and fans meet-n-greet, we got a chance to link up with them for an interview.
